Abstract

The utility model discloses a bent pipe clamping device which mainly comprises a rotary base, a supporting upright, a lower hoop, an upper hoop and an inner clamping ring, wherein the rotary base is provided with a center hole to be conveniently connected with a rotating platform; the supporting upright passes through a circular curve waist-shaped hole to be connected with the rotary base by a screw; the rotary base is provided with a rotary positioning groove; the lower part of the lower hoop is provided with a guide block; the guide block is inserted into the supporting upright; after a tightening screw is screwed down, the lower hoop is combined with a supporting block into one body; and the inner clamping ring is clung to the inside of the upper hoop and the lower hoop. The bent pipe clamping device provided by the utility model meets the requirement for clamping when a bent pipe is turned and cut, can be separately used and also can be combined for use so as to adapt to turning and cutting of a small batch of bent pipe structures with various specifications, which are made of various materials.

Background technology
In the Aeronautics and Astronautics field, there is a large amount of bend pipe structure unit, these unit major parts all are to coordinate for size, need to remove the part process allowance, often need to cut at the coordination scene, operation such as grinding, and after requiring cutting to remove surplus, parting surface meets certain requirements to center of circle linearity and flatness.Present conventional way adopts abrasive wheel cutting machine to remove surplus for the bigger bend pipe of wall thickness usually, and the less employing tinsmith snips of thickness cut off, and uses Large Sand wheel disc grinding end face, satisfies follow-up welding needs.This kind method comes with some shortcomings, and the abrasive wheel cutting machine cut quality is poor, causes burr, overlap more, and the end face flatness is relatively poor, and the method for using tinsmith snips to cut off surplus only can be used for wall thickness less than the bend pipe of 1.0mm, be difficult to enlarge the scope of application.During Large Sand wheel disc grinding end face, need carry out flatness at any time and review, inefficiency, and relatively poor to crooked center of circle linearity.
